Steve Brandt has been previously licensed with The Strategic Financial Alliance, Inc., LPL Financial LLC and Cetera Advisors LLC. FINRA reports that an arbitration claim involving Steve Brandt’s conduct with Cetera Advisors LLC was filed. FINRA reports that Steve Brandt was a subject of the customer’s complaint against Steve Brandt’s member firm that asserted the following causes of action: unsuitable investments and investment strategy, failure of duty to provide information, failure to supervise, vicarious liability, breach of contract, violations of securities regulatory rules, common law claims, and violations of Maryland Securities Laws. FINRA reports that Steve Brandt’s member firm is liable and ordered to pay to the Claimant compensatory damages in the amount of $43,500 plus interest.
